This episode from December of 2023 shares Warren's conversation with Dr. Keith Williams, Assistant Professor at Athabasca University and adjunct faculty at First Nations Technical Institute. Keith holds a Bachelor Degree in Agriculture, a teaching degree, a Masters Degree in Mycology, and a Ph.D. with a focus on Indigenous Philosophy. Warren and Keith will discuss Indigenous food systems and philosophy and the healing benefits of some fungi.Dr. Keith Williams lives in Mi’kma’ki (Nova Scotia) and he has paternal family roots from a Mohawk (Haudenosaunee) community on the northern shores of Lake Ontario although he does not identify as Indigenous.
